Output d0640241e140181244c3bb1a8e2f9f3f9281621ac6e85d1d1403b21b35914861:1

value
8795904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 259451434be043424846ec0d5dd26015a4efd1ff OP_EQUAL
address
357ibvANY4YBHbi8CHAmk3Jsz6PMWRo5zx
transaction
d0640241e140181244c3bb1a8e2f9f3f9281621ac6e85d1d1403b21b35914861
spent
true